Output c3961b72eaea51e4cff9b707968daa09de5d40064203ddb443748b1cdd299c68:1

value
42982543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ebff447d28f211bd78ad3e1d50c38d690bd83a OP_EQUAL
address
3CFxLyPALeg17c2WzPqrAVic6x454h9V72
transaction
c3961b72eaea51e4cff9b707968daa09de5d40064203ddb443748b1cdd299c68
confirmations
317266
spent
true